Stalwart Aussie artist Machine Translations — also known as J Walker, or Greg Walker if you're being formal — is set to release a killer new full-length, Oh, this month, and ahead of its arrival he's gifted The Music with the premiere look at the awesome animated clip for fresh track Sola.

Created by Walker's old friend Jonathan Nix, the video takes a twisted, frequently psychedelic look at the digital device revolution — and ensuing addiction — that has taken over our daily lives, for better and worse. The end result is super cool and a perfect accompaniment to the tune's infectious discord.

"We share a lot of musical and artistic roots," Walker said of bringing Nix aboard to craft the film clip. "He really loved the song and it was a real luxury to be able to give him total free rein with it, as I knew he'd do something amazing."

Sola follows recent single Parliament Of Spiders in setting the stage for Oh's release, due on Friday 10 November through revered indie label Spunk Records. The follow-up to 2013's The Bright Door, the album stands as a focused growth of Walker's previous work, with a particular eye on being as direct as possible in his compositions.

"My whole thing with this record was to keep things more elemental and immediate," he said.

Machine Translations will be playing a run of shows this month in celebration of the record's landing, kicking off at Brighton Up Bar in Sydney on Thursday 9 November, and heading on to additional dates in Thirroul, Melbourne and Castlemaine.
